HB 3034
Establishing the West Virginia TEACH Scholarship Program

Bill overview
This bill establishes the West Virginia TEACH Scholarship Program, aiming to improve the quality of childcare in the state and boost workforce participation. It would provide scholarships to individuals working in eligible childcare facilities who pursue degrees in early childhood education. The West Virginia Higher Education Policy Commission would administer the program, awarding scholarships based on eligibility requirements and renewal conditions. The program also includes provisions for reporting information and establishing a dedicated scholarship fund.
